Analytical model of the electrical characteristics of linear MHD generators
Description
A two-dimensional electrical model of multi-electrode linear generators is presented. The electrode-wall boundary layers are included in the treatment, and an allowance can be made for the effects of electrode arcs and slag layers. The external electrical properties of the MHD channel flow are defined by a set of four resistance matrices. Analytical expressions for the matrix elements are given. The formulation allows a rapid, straightforward determination of a generator's electrical characteristics and is suitable for analyzing the electrical nonuniformities often observed in slagging channels. 26 references
